What companies run services between Greenock, Scotland and Lochgoilhead, Scotland?

There is no direct connection from Greenock to Lochgoilhead. However, you can take the train to Gourock, walk to Gourock Ferry Terminal, take the ferry to Dunoon Ferry Terminal, walk to Ferry Terminal, then take the bus to Car Park. Alternatively, you can drive from Greenock to Lochgoilhead in around 1h 4m.
